ll Praises Due. I've just received a copy of Die Gestalten's newest volume in their seminal logotype compendium: Tres Logos. Fresh off the presses, and draped in all it's Blue Regalia this book offers testament to anyone interested in how we as humans create and establish — Brands, Myths + Ideas simply by attaching a mark. It seems to me that in modern times the Logo ( or Logotype ) has overrun classical / anthropological ideas of symbolism by essentially flooding the visual idiom with an infinite amount of iconic marks. I'm proud to say that I have actively participated in this deconstruction of symbolism. I've added my mark to the modern visual landscape, and have now had this documented in Tome Form.

6 Logomarks featured / Including two of my Typefaces .
